Law Bear Injury Lawyers Establishes Phoenix Headquarters Following Supreme Court Approval

Law Bear Injury Lawyers has officially established its headquarters in Phoenix, Arizona, following the firm's recent approval by the Arizona Supreme Court under the state's Alternative Business Structure (ABS) program. The new office, located at 2375 E. Camelback Rd., Suite 635, in the city's Camelback Corridor, will serve as the operational hub for the firm's statewide personal injury practice, reinforcing its long-term dedication to injured individuals and families throughout Arizona.

The headquarters centralizes legal operations, case management, client intake, and administrative functions, supporting clients across the state with a particular focus on the greater Phoenix metropolitan area. An 11-person core team, including a managing attorney, senior case manager, intake professionals, operations leadership, and administrative staff, will work from this location to ensure responsive client service and efficient case management. Two members of the six-person intake department are based in Phoenix, while additional leadership personnel work remotely to support firm operations across Arizona.

Sean Schmitt, president of Law Bear Injury Lawyers, will oversee the firm's operational strategy, client service standards, and long-term growth initiatives from the headquarters. The office serves as the central hub for legal operations, providing a permanent Arizona presence for clients seeking representation after serious motor vehicle accidents and other personal injury incidents. The firm's primary practice areas include car accidents, truck accidents, and wrongful death claims, as well as other personal injury matters arising from negligence.

The headquarters also serves as the operational foundation for Law Bear's Alternative Business Structure model. Arizona is one of only a handful of states that permits approved law firms to operate under this regulatory framework, which combines innovation in legal services with oversight by the Arizona Supreme Court. This approval allows Law Bear to integrate modern operational systems designed to promote transparency, accountability, and client service, setting it apart in the legal community.
